Changes of Recommendation. Except as provided in Section 7.21(e) below, neither the Board nor any committee thereof shall (i) (A) withdraw or qualify (or amend or modify in a manner adverse to Purchaser), or fail to make the approval, recommendation or declaration of advisability by the Board or any committee thereof of this Agreement, or the transactions contemplated by this Agreement, (B) recommend, adopt or approve any Alternative Transaction Proposal, (C) publicly make any recommendation in connection with an Alternative Transaction Proposal other than a recommendation against such proposal, or (D) if an Alternative Transaction Proposal shall have been publicly announced or disclosed, if so requested by Purchaser, fail to recommend against such Alternative Transaction Proposal or fail to reaffirm the approval, recommendation and declaration of advisability of this Agreement and the transactions contemplated by this Agreement, on or prior to the fourth (4th) Business Day after the Alternative Transaction Proposal shall have been publicly announced or disclosed (any action described in this clause (i) being referred to as an “Adverse Recommendation Change”) or (ii) approve or recommend or allow Seller or any of its Affiliates to execute or enter into, any letter of intent, memorandum of understanding, agreement in principle, merger agreement, acquisition agreement, option agreement, joint venture agreement, partnership agreement or other similar agreement, arrangement or understanding (A) relating to any Alternative Transaction Proposal or any offer or proposal that would reasonably be expected to lead to an Alternative Transaction Proposal or (B) requiring it (or that would require it) to abandon, terminate or fail to consummate the transactions contemplated by this Agreement.
